-1947 SAUDI ARAB PHILADELPHIA MINT POUND NGC MS63

(1947) Gold One Pound, KM-35, MS63 NGC. This is the famous gold pound used for oil payments to Saudi Arabia. The gold weight is the same as found in the British sovereign. The obverse features a Heraldic Eagle design, inscribed U.S. MINT above, and PHILADELPHIA - U.S.A. below. The reverse has the three line inscription CONTAINS .2354 TROY OZS. FINE GOLD. One of the few gold coin issues struck by the U.S. Mint during the era when American private gold ownership was illegal. This example is well preserved and offers excellent eye appeal.
